WebNondrug approaches such as exercise and good sleep habits can also help manage symptoms. Research has repeatedly shown that regular exercise is one of the most effective treatments for fibromyalgia. People with fibromyalgia who have too much pain or fatigue to do vigorous exercise should begin with walking or other gentle exercise and build ... WebSome guidelines: Start slow. Avoid increasing exercise volume by more than 10% in one day. When possible, go for lower-impact exercise (water workouts, cycling, walking, yoga, bodyweight resistance work). Prioritize aerobic capacity, focusing your efforts at one or two steps above “easy.”.
